Hey tech fam! 🚀 The Chinese mainland Ministry of Commerce announced on Saturday an anti-dumping investigation into certain analog IC chips originating from the United States. What’s this all about?
🔍 Anti-dumping 101: This probe checks if U.S. chips sold in the Chinese mainland market are priced unfairly low, potentially undercutting local manufacturers. If dumping is found, additional duties may apply.
📱 Why it matters: Analog IC chips power your smartphones, wearables and IoT gadgets. Any change in import costs might ripple into device prices or supply chains.
🛠 Next steps: The investigation kicks off with a review period, public comments and data collection. A final ruling could take several months based on the Ministry’s findings.
